Want a Better Workout? Prepare in Advance!
Countless numbers of people stream through the doors of gyms around the world without knowing what kind of workout they're going to do. They don't know what body parts they're going to work on, they don't know what exercises they're going to do, they don't even know if they're going to do weights or cardio. Many people just show up to the gym and "just do whatever machines are free"

This is absolutely ludicrous if you want results.

I know there are people who go to the gym and have other motives- like finding a date for Saturday night or as someone told me last week "just to get my blood moving". I imagine if you're reading our newsletter you're not in this category. Chances are that you want a specific result- like lose some weight and get in decent shape.

Every result has a specific set of actions that get you to that result. If you're going from New York to San Diego, you don't just get in the car and drive and hope you end up there. You get on Google maps and figure out exactly how to get there. The same thing applies in affecting change in your body.

Before you touch the weight or your foot hits the pedal on your elliptical, know exactly what you're striving for. Do you want to burn a certain amount of calories? Do you want to perform at a certain level of intensity for a specific amount of time? Plan it in advance. There are more reasons to do this than you know. Want Results? Take Action!
If you want results- any results, the bottom line is that you MUST take action.

You can sit down and read all the information on the internet about getting lean, losing weight, starting a business, whatever... It's not going to amount to a hill of beans if you don't MOVE.

Any time you get an idea take action.
Any time you get excited about the idea of finally losing those 50 pounds, take action.

It doesn't matter what action. Just take action.

Once you're in motion, you'll stay in motion. While you're in motion, you can figure out the best actions to take.

Each time you physically move and take an action toward the achievement of your goal, you condition yourself in a way that makes it easier next time.

Each time you DON'T physically move and take an action toward your goal, you condition yourself in a way that makes it more difficult next time.

When you get an idea or get inspired about something, MOVE.
